USB switchover between MS (massStorage) and CD (Communication Device) Mode

uC starts in CD (communication) mode via a virtual Com Port on your computer. When sending the command ;MS; via Terminal from PC to uC, the uC starts into Mass Storage mode and SD Card shows up as USB Stick on your Computer. Remove of USB Cable or using External Interrupt disables MS mode and turns uC into CD Mode...

Power PIC32 down into SLEEP mode and wake up via RTC ALARM by INTERRUPT

This is the Program structure of a power saving example. Pic32 starts and works at 8Mhz without PLL for low current consumption. When shutting down, 8Mhz crystal and all Modules are deaktivated but SOSC is enabled to be able to wake up CPU by RTC ALARM Interrupt.
